Five Bristol Ladies Called Up For England

England Women face crunch match with France Women in Paris

08th March 2012 published by Tom Tainton

Five Bristol Ladies have been named in England Women’s starting line up for the potential RBS Six Nations title decider against France on Sunday at the Stade Charlety in Paris (12.45pm KO).

Marlie Packer switches from openside to blindside, Sophie Hemming starts at prop while Kay Wilson is named on the wing.

Kim Oliver and Izyy Noel-Smith are included among the replacements as England seek to continue their unbeaten start to the campaign.

England, who head into Sunday’s match on the back of victories over Scotland, Italy and Wales, could secure a seventh consecutive title this year, having already notched 123 points and conceded just 3.

“We have performed well over the last three games but we are now at the business end of the championship and it is important that we have consistency in the starting line up,” said Head Coach Gary Street.

“This is a strong England side ready for a very big game against a powerful French outfit that’ll be looking to upset our run.”

The game is available to watch on Sunday via the red button on Sky Sports 2HD.

Meanwhile, Bristol’s Becky Hughes and Megan Oaten will start for England Women U20s against France, while Claire Molloy starts in the back row for Ireland Women versus Scotland Women at Ashbourne RFC on Friday (7.30pm KO).
